About the Audi S4 Cabriolet

Produced between 2002 and 2009, the Audi S4 Cabriolet (B6 and B7 generations) featured a 4.2-litre V8 engine producing 344bhp. This four-seater convertible delivered 0-62mph in 5.9 seconds whilst maintaining Audi's reputation for build quality and refinement. Standard equipment included leather sports seats, xenon headlights, and the renowned quattro four-wheel-drive system. The B7 facelift from 2006 onwards brought revised styling, improved interior materials and updated technology.

What Affects the Price

Age and mileage are primary factors, with earlier B6 models (2002-2005) starting from around £8,000, whilst later B7 versions (2006-2009) command £15,000 to £45,000. Full Audi service history significantly increases value, as does evidence of major maintenance like timing chain replacement. Condition of the fabric roof and its operation is crucial—replacement costs are substantial. Low-mileage examples under 60,000 miles attract premium prices. Colour combinations matter, with popular shades like Phantom Black or Daytona Grey holding value better than unusual colours. Optional extras such as satellite navigation, Bang & Olufsen audio, and heated seats add appeal.

Buying Tips

Check the soft-top mechanism thoroughly for smooth operation and inspect the rear screen for cracks or delamination. Request evidence of timing chain and tensioner replacement—failure is common around 80,000 miles and repairs exceed £2,000. Examine service records for regular oil changes using correct specifications, as the V8 engine is sensitive to maintenance quality. Inspect for carbon build-up symptoms including rough idling or poor fuel economy. Check the quattro system engages properly and listen for worn differential bearings. Verify electric seat operation and climate control function, as repairs are expensive. A pre-purchase inspection at an Audi specialist is strongly recommended given the complex mechanical systems.
